What’s the difference between BMW X3 28i and 35i?


Sharing is Caring


The base engine in the rear-drive X3 sDrive28i and all-wheel-drive X3 xDrive 28i is a turbocharged 2.0-liter I-4 rated at 240 hp and 258 lb-ft of torque. … The turbocharged 3.0-liter I-6 in the AWD-only X3 xDrive35i is rated 300 hp and 300 lb-ft.

What is the difference between the BMW 30i and 28i?

Although the 30i designation suggests that BMW’s 3.0-liter inline-six is present, it actually has a 2.0-liter inline-four. (The 28i was the previous four-cylinder X3). The six-cylinder version has been elevated to M Performance status and is now badged X3 M40i.

What does xDrive30i mean for BMW?

In BMW speak, xDrive means all-wheel drive (AWD), which bumps up the overall cost from the base sDrive30i model. The 30i references the entry-level engine. In this case, that engine is a 2.0-liter turbocharged four-cylinder (248 horsepower, 258 lb-ft of torque).

What are the BMW X3 trim levels?

The BMW X3 is offered in three main versions, differentiated by their powertrains: sDrive30i, xDrive30i, and M40i. The sDrive30i and xDrive30i models features the same turbocharged 2.0-liter four-cylinder engine (248 horsepower, 258 pound-feet of torque) matched with an eight-speed shiftable automatic transmission.

What are the common problems with BMW X3?

  • Engine oil leaks (valve cover & gasket)
  • Sunroof rattle and leak.
  • Timing chain guide failure.
  • Window rattle and broken regulators.
  • Overheating from radiator and expansion tank leaks.

Is BMW X3 reliable?

Is the BMW X3 Reliable? The 2022 BMW X3 has a predicted reliability score of 81 out of 100. A J.D. Power predicted reliability score of 91-100 is considered the Best, 81-90 is Great, 70-80 is Average, and 0-69 is Fair and considered below average.

Is xDrive the same as all-wheel drive?

xDrive is classed as ‘all-wheel drive’. In the standard system during normal driving, 40 per cent of the power is sent to the front wheels and 60 per cent is sent to the rear.
